Jeff King <peff@peff.net> writes:

>> +test_expect_success 'malformed mode in tree' '
>> +	test_must_fail git hash-object -t tree ../t1007/tree-with-malformed-mode 2>err &&
>> +	grep "malformed mode in tree entry for tree" err
>> +'
>
> This ".." will break when the test is run with "--root". You should use
>
>   "$TEST_DIRECTORY"/t1007/...
>
> instead. And ditto in the second test, of course.
